WHS lacrosse nets first shutout since ’07

0

Recording its first shutout in nine seasons, the Wilmington High School club lacrosse team opened its season Monday with a 10-0 win over Taylor.

Hurricane senior Zane Stevens scored four goals to lead the offensive attack.

Josiah Keiter, a senior, had three goals while TraLee Joiner, a junior, added two goals. Sophomore Cody Cravens also had a goal for Wilmington.

Coach Adam Shultz said the shutout was the school’s first since the 2007 season.

“The team earned this win,” Shultz said. “Our players all worked hard for this one.”

Wilmington will play 6 p.m. Wednesday at the Eagles Lacrosse Club.
